Politico: Trump Allies Push White House to Consider Regime Change in Tehran

Trita Parsi, founder of the National Iranian American Council, said a U.S. strategy of trying to undermine Iran’s government would undo progress Obama had made. “If you put regime change back on the table, it is a complete reversal of what has been achieved thus far. Through the nuclear deal, there were channels of communication and even cooperation,” Parsi said. Parsi argued that Rouhani’s reelection was a victory for reformers who have placed their hopes for changing Iran on gradual political reform, not mass street protests. “The people have essentially chosen that they want to reform the system from within,” he said. “The hard-liners could hardly hide their pleasure in seeing the U.S. take on that position.”
